SCIENCE FAIR KICK-OFF ASSEMBLIES

February 28, 9:30am:  Grades Kindergarten – 2nd

Heat! Light! Gas! Color change! Explode on the scene with RADICAL REACTIONS where flames are blue and green, rainbows exist in glass tubes, and dollar bills catch fire. In this dynamic show, chemical reactions abound in an exciting line-up that keeps audiences of all ages on the edges of their seats. See our presenter throw fire, watch an ordinary Ziploc turn into an exploding yellow bag, and fall in love with the foam fountain finale in this lively yet fact-filled demonstration!

March 1, 9:30am: Grades 3rd– 5th  

The three states of matter...do they matter? Dive into the weird world of the SUPER COOL where gases become liquids and liquids become solids. In this fast-paced show, liquid nitrogen takes center stage in a variety of experiments with surprising results. Check out the Inter-Planetary Olympics - what is it like to bounce a racquetball or munch a graham cracker in the sub-zero temperatures of Pluto? Find out what causes
matter to fizz, freeze, foam, and fly in the frigid zones of minus degrees!
